Documentary about contemporary artists and how they repond to
consumerism through their work. The artists featured in the
programme include Barbara Kruger, Michael Ray Charles, Matthew
Barney, Andrea Zittel and Mel Chin.
Over the course of about ten years, Hans Ulrich Obrist and Matthew
Barney met several times to discuss Barney's past work, current
projects and his plans for the future. The resulting collection of
interviews provides a rare insight into how the work and working
method of one of the most prominent artists of a generation has
developed over time, and uncovers the ideas, influences and
collaborations that lie behind his multi-layered and multimedia
creative output. The conversation covers all of his major pieces to
date, from the internationally acclaimed "Cremaster" cycle to the
somewhat less well-known "Drawing Restraint" series, as well as
looking at particular projects in more detail, such as the recent
"Khu" performance and Barney's participation in "Il Tempo del
Postino," curated by Obrist at the 2007 Manchester International
Festival.
